Strategic purpose statement:
The purpose of this qualification is to provide the infrastructure works industry with people who are
able to safely and effectively operate plant and equipment in a range of contexts.
The level of technical skills and responsibility of plant operators is critical in ensuring the quality of
our infrastructure, and the safety of operators, the public and structures.
This qualification is for those wanting to solely focus on operating plant and equipment; and/or apply
their skills in the civil, surfacing and underground utilities sectors.

Special conditions related to this qualification:
Although this qualification is achievable as a stand-alone qualification for those wanting to solely
focus on operating plant and equipment; it is recommended that candidates achieve the New
Zealand Certificate in Infrastructure Works (Level 3), or equivalent knowledge, skills and experience,
prior to this qualification, to gain a good understanding of operating in an infrastructure works
environment.
A minimum of TC Level 1 and appropriate licences and endorsements to operate plant must be
attained - D, F, W, T, R
Transition arrangements:
1
People currently working towards any of the replaced qualifications may either complete the requirements for
that qualification by 31 December 2016 or transfer to this qualification. It is important to note that the replaced
qualifications may be substantially different to the new qualification, and may relate to more than one new
qualification. The last date for entry into programmes leading to the replaced qualifications is 31 December
2015.
